Publisher's Summary
The apocalypse will be televised!
A man. His ex-girlfriend's cat. A sadistic game show unlike anything in the universe: a dungeon crawl where survival depends on killing your prey in the most entertaining way possible.
In a flash, every human-erected construction on Earth - from Buckingham Palace to the tiniest of sheds - collapses in a heap, sinking into the ground.
The buildings and all the people inside have all been atomized and transformed into the dungeon: an 18-level labyrinth filled with traps, monsters, and loot. A dungeon so enormous, it circles the entire globe.
Only a few dare venture inside. But once you're in, you can't get out. And what's worse, each level has a time limit. You have but days to find a staircase to the next level down, or it's game over. In this game, it's not about your strength or your dexterity. It's about your followers, your views. Your clout. It's about building an audience and killing those goblins with style.
You can't just survive here. You gotta survive big.
You gotta fight with vigor, with excitement. You gotta make them stand up and cheer. And if you do have that "it" factor, you may just find yourself with a following. That's the only way to truly survive in this game - with the help of the loot boxes dropped upon you by the generous benefactors watching from across the galaxy.
They call it Dungeon Crawler World. But for Carl, it's anything but a game.

Great MC
I love the book so if you're reading the reviews to get an idea on if you should buy it then let me explain the Mc, Carl
He's a nobody. Completely ordinary guy like someone you'd walk by on the street and not think twice about. But he's also a Hero.
In this universe, life is cheap(literally) and death is so abundant that genocide of entire planets isn't a warcrime but entertainment in the form of dungeon crawls. It's in this dungeon that the crawlers, the few million that survived the initial culling, are forced to kill or be killed, eventually numbing them to life just like everyone else.
In this universe that utterly breaks a person's morals and empathy, that shatters any sense of compassion, Carl is just a normal guy. But it's this world that molds him into a Hero for the simple fact that he chooses to care.
They took everything from him but one thing they'll never do to him is break him. Instead, he'll break them.

A "Regular Guy" gets caught up in the Apocalypse
First thing's first. Jeff Hayes is one of the best narrators out there. He perfectly captures characters just by his tone alone. He has an amazing ability to adapt his tone/depth/pace/pronunciation to every unique character. If I'm being honest, this audiobook wouldn't have done well without him. Don't take the aforementioned point as a dig against the author, but rather, that this narrator brings so much life to the writing that this audiobook can be considered a creative art piece brought together by two artists (the author and the narrator). Quite simply, the writer pitches him good material and then Hayes knocks it out of the park.
The author is good. He creates characters that are very unique. Even in his follow-on books, he does a (really) good job creating unique and interesting characters even if they are only around for a small period of time in the narrative. He doesn't spend a long time on descriptive writing for his combat scenes which is something that I'm fine with (happy about, even) so keep that in mind when listening to the audiobook; You'll be quickly imagining the combat scenes with not much descriptive material to go with. On the other hand, he has very good descriptive writing for the parts that matter more in context of the storyline. Most importantly, there were several times where I "Laughed Out Loud" in the literal sense. I'm generally not an excitable person, so if it got me, than I'm sure that it'll get you. The humor here was fantastic.
I listened to the series back-to-back and am eager to listen see where the series goes.
The only drawback about this whole series is that it isn't as well advertised as it should be. Audible.com should be pushing this in it's advertising. I only heard about it by word-of-mouth on another platform. I don't care about LitRPG books, so I assume that's one of the reasons this book wasn't pushed to my "recommended" feed. That said, this book is so good that it would actually get people into the audiobook genre of media.

A refreshing take on apocalyptical LITRPG
So...this book. Man, I just love it. Somehow, the author managed to avoid almost every LITRPG hero trope that exists and made that a good thing. Except the snarky system messages, but, let's be real, that's one of the genre's more fun tropes.
* SOUND BOOTH THEATER KNOCKS THIS OUT OF THE PARK! JEFF HAYES IS THE MAN! No distracting music or sound affects that aren't pertinent to the story. Proper voices for the system notifications and other messages. Just...nailed this 100%
* MC is not dumb
* MC is not a womanizer
* MC is not gifted with some super, ultra rare ability that breaks the game or makes him a snowflake
* MC does solve everything (or anything) with magic (...I love magic...I'm keeping my fingers crossed this might change)
* MC is practically McGyver (like the real McGyver not the Dr. Who sonic screw driver McGyver)
* MC has good dialogue with other characters and his companion whom happens to be a talking cat (happens in first 35 minutes...not really a spoiler)
* MC (and all of humanity) is definitely the underdog
Now, the LITRPG aspects.
* A$$hole corporate, inter-galactic politics and greed cause the apocalyptic event
* While the story progresses well with Carl's progress in levels and skills, there are bigger, deeper story arcs being threaded so this isn't just an apocalypse for no reason.
* The system seems to be absolutely massive as far as ability & class options go.
Definitely 5 stars all the way.
